Commute – Pure annoyingness… on wheels!

Edamame Reviews has always been about giving our honest opinions… Kiary Games, how could you have ever made the simple task of “going to work” any more annoying…!

Commute is a game about going to work. More specifically going to work in seriously heavy traffic with brakes that “sort of” work. Your mission in this game is to survive what may be the longest traffic jam in the world. Continually stopping and going, your first challenge in this game is to stop without bumping into the car in front of you.

You see, your car’s brakes in this game – although useable – aren’t the best, meaning your car won’t stop anywhere near as fast as you would often like it to…😫  Once you’ve finally stopped bumping the cars in front of you (and behind of course…) it’s time to change lanes…

By swiping either left or right you can squeeze into gaps so as to get to work faster (Who would want to do that?) and gain points. Although relatively easy in the real world, in Commute a simple action such as switching lanes is often fatal, and requires an insanely high level of skill and technique.

To be completely honest this game is extremely annoying, but for some unknown reason we seem to keep coming back to it…

If you would like to play what may one day be known as the saddest “racing game” in the world, (Dude, let’s race to work! …What are we doing…😓 ) you’ve probably found it here…

Although annoying and a little sad, Commute has the same sort of addictive properties found in Flappy Bird and for some reason keeps us coming back for more over and over again…
